Official abstract text for this publication.
Securing access to a portable electronic device (PED), securing e-commerce transactions at an electronic device (ED) and dynamically adjusting system settings at a PED are disclosed. In an example, usage or mobility characteristics of the PED or ED (e.g., a location of the ED or PED, etc.) are compared with current parameters of the PED or ED. A determination as to whether to permit an operation (e.g., access, e-commerce transaction, etc.) at the ED or PED can be based at least in part upon a degree to which the current parameters conform with the usage or mobility characteristics. In another example, at least a current location of a PED can be used to determine which system settings to load at the PED.
